Monica Bilan

Information Specialist - Student Services McMaster University Continuing Education

Job Description

I help adults (individuals 18+ years of age) select an academic program that matches their career goals, if we offer a related program at McMaster Continuing Education. In addition, I assist with creating study plans, share information about academic policies and procedures, discuss career paths applicable to our programs, and connect students to support services as needed.

Career Story

After high school I went to McMaster University to complete an Honours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ology. I volunteered during the last 2 years of my undergraduate degree studies to see what I enjoyed doing. I volunteered at a children’s aid organization tutoring students, answering phone calls for a help/crisis line, and assisted with a career fair that McMaster hosted. After university I volunteered at an employment resource centre while working a survival job. That volunteer job led to permanent employment with that company where I facilitated job search workshops, helped individuals update/create a resume, and provided career advice and guidance. I found an interest in researching academic programs for individuals interested in a career change which eventually led me to apply for the role I am still in today. About 5 years ago I completed a Masters of Education graduate degree which will support me in career advancement within the university.

Land Acknowledgement

Flamborough is in the Treaty territory of the Mississaugas of the Credit First Nation (http://mncfn.ca), as well as lands used by the Haudenosaunee (Ho-den-oh-sew-nee) Confederacy and Wendat Confederacy. This territory is covered in a number of Treaties including the Treaty of Niagara (1764) and the Silver Covenant Chain of Friendship.
